Read More
Home/Science News/Florida’s 76,000 stormwater ponds emit more carbon than they store Science News Florida’s 76,000 stormwater ponds emit more carbon than they store 10th March 20220 19 Less than a minute Read More 10th March 20220 19 Less than a minute Show More